| If sinfield is still out I would hope that we target peacock heavily at belle vue.
The amount of times peacock was first reciever with burrows running behind waiting for a pass from peacock was apparent for all to see and allowed burrows space to run laterally with space in front of him.
If peacock is again the first reciever I'd hope we get in his face so that he has no or less time to pass to burrows or we have a player designated to stop burrows lateral runs. Then again that's a tricky one as we did defend well and maybe we would be playing into burrows hands by having a player trying to cut him off so he can step inside.
Be interesting to see if our structure is tweaked to try and address this or remains with hopefully the same attitude and effort applied in defence but more composure in attack.
